Advertisement
Advertisement

MTX

MTX logo

Minerals Technologies Inc

58.84
USD
+1.29
+2.24%
Apr 24, 15:59 UTC -4
Closed
exchange

Pre-Market

58.83

+0.03
+0.05%

MTX Historical Data

Advertisement